Home | History | Annotate | Download | only in functional

Lines Matching refs:m_textureSpec

242 	TextureSpec				m_textureSpec;
254 , m_textureSpec (texture)
328 tcu::TextureFormat texFmt = glu::mapGLTransferFormat(m_textureSpec.format, m_textureSpec.dataType);
334 switch (m_textureSpec.type)
338 float cStep = 1.0f / (float)de::max(1, m_textureSpec.numLevels-1);
341 int baseCellSize = de::min(m_textureSpec.width/4, m_textureSpec.height/4);
343 m_texture2D = new glu::Texture2D(m_renderCtx, m_textureSpec.format, m_textureSpec.dataType, m_textureSpec.width, m_textureSpec.height);
344 for (int level = 0; level < m_textureSpec.numLevels; level++)
357 float dudx = (m_lookupSpec.maxCoord[0]-m_lookupSpec.minCoord[0])*proj*m_textureSpec.width / (float)viewportSize[0];
358 float dvdy = (m_lookupSpec.maxCoord[1]-m_lookupSpec.minCoord[1])*proj*m_textureSpec.height / (float)viewportSize[1];
362 m_textures.push_back(gls::TextureBinding(m_texture2D, m_textureSpec.sampler));
368 float cStep = 1.0f / (float)de::max(1, m_textureSpec.numLevels-1);
371 int baseCellSize = de::min(m_textureSpec.width/4, m_textureSpec.height/4);
373 DE_ASSERT(m_textureSpec.width == m_textureSpec.height);
374 m_textureCube = new glu::TextureCube(m_renderCtx, m_textureSpec.format, m_textureSpec.dataType, m_textureSpec.width);
375 for (int level = 0; level < m_textureSpec.numLevels; level++)
402 float dudx = (c10.s - c00.s)*m_textureSpec.width / (float)viewportSize[0];
403 float dvdy = (c01.t - c00.t)*m_textureSpec.height / (float)viewportSize[1];
407 m_textures.push_back(gls::TextureBinding(m_textureCube, m_textureSpec.sampler));
425 bool is2DProj4 = m_textureSpec.type == TEXTURETYPE_2D && (function == FUNCTION_TEXTUREPROJ || function == FUNCTION_TEXTUREPROJLOD);
427 int texCoordComps = m_textureSpec.type == TEXTURETYPE_2D ? 2 : 3;
433 tcu::TextureFormat texFmt = glu::mapGLTransferFormat(m_textureSpec.format, m_textureSpec.dataType);
435 const char* baseFuncName = m_textureSpec.type == TEXTURETYPE_2D ? "texture2D" : "textureCube";
438 switch (m_textureSpec.type)